Merkel wins as South Europe waited for changes
Angela Merkel won the Sunday-held Bundestag election with 41% of votes and will most probably remain the Chancellor for four more years. Despite that, the Southern Europe did not expect such a result, as they blame Merkel for spending cuts, unemployment and debt crisis. Now they hope for a Merkel coalition with Social Democrats that can change the current crisis
